WesterliesDominant winds of the mid-latitudes. These winds move from the subtropical highs to the subpolar lows from west to east.

WesterliesThe global winds at middle latitudes, from west to east. The westerlies are the reason why weather patterns in the US often migrate from west to east. See jet stream.
